The Pitman Arm transfers the rotational movement from the steering box to the steering linkage, converting the driver’s input into lateral motion to steer the wheels. It is commonly found in trucks and vehicles with a recirculating ball steering system. Proper function of the pitman arm is essential for accurate steering response and vehicle control.
